    Wrestler Silver King dies after 'collapsing in ring at London show'

    The former WCW star, who starred opposite Jack Black in 2006 comedy Nacho Libre, had been performing at the Roundhouse in Camden.

    Former WCW wrestler Silver King has died after reportedly collapsing in the ring during a show in London.

    The 51-year-old, who starred opposite Hollywood star Jack Black in the 2006 comedy Nacho Libre, had been performing at the Roundhouse in Camden on Saturday evening.

    Organisers of the Lucha Libre show confirmed his death as tributes poured in for the Mexican, whose real name was Cesar Barron

    According to Camden New Journal, Silver King's co-performers did not initially realise there was a problem after he collapsed following a kick to the side of his body.

    He was turned over and counted out but when he failed to recover, a team of medics rushed on stage, the newspaper said.


    Fans chanted "Silver, Silver" before the audience was told there would be a short break but the venue was cleared out shortly afterwards, it was reported.

    A member of the audience told the Camden New Journal: "It seemed to be part of the show at first but then he didn't get up - and then the medical team was on the stage.
